Wales Vets 0-5 Army Masters

On Saturday 19 October, the Army Masters travelled to a sun filled Jenner Park stadium in Barry, South Wales to take on Wales Vets FC.

The game started at a frenetic pace and after just two minutes, a great cross by WO1 Chris Watts RS found WO2 Adamson RLC who headed home to make it 1-0. The Army continued to dominate, the midfield three of SSgt Riley RA, WO2 Rizza RS and SSgt Griffiths RE running the show.

In the 10th minute a great corner by WO1 Watts found Capt Steve Davies RA who walloped a volley into the top corner. 

On 22 Minutes Cpl Rob Storey RE put Adamson clear through on goal who put the ball on a plate for SSgt Aaron Creighton RS who made it 3-0. The Army continued to press high, creating plenty of chances and just before halftime a poor clearance from the Wales keeper found the feet of WO2 Riley, who stayed composed from 30 yards out and slotted the ball into an empty net, that sent the Army in at halftime 4 - 0 up.

The second half was a completely different game that saw Wales dominate for the majority of the half. The Army's back four, led by WO2 Alan Jordan RS dealt with everything thrown at them and Goalkeeper Maj Gav Smyth RA was there to assist making three fantastic saves and ensuring the Army didn’t concede.

On the 76 minute SSgt Gaz Loveridge RLC caught Wales napping and hit them on the break, his drilled cross found Adamson, who slotted home from close range, making it five.

Wales continued to press for the last 10 minutes but couldn’t find a way through, the game finished Army Master 5 - 0 Wales Vets.
